This week's Profile is Brian Taylor of Philadelphia. Philly Fashion guru Sabir Peele tells us why Brian is this week's That Guy.
What I like about this look?
This is look is a great representation of how well-tailored clothing can be fun and not stuffy. The pattern of the blazer is an understated Glen plaid, which adds a very cool "Rat-Pack" style to this look. Most guys stay away from shoes and other accessories that do not fall into neutral color, however; Brian really takes a risky, but, effective style-leap with his red leather boots and red-frame lens-less glasses.
Where could this outfit be worn?
I ran into him at the Best of Style event hosted by Philly Style Magazine and learned that he is a director at the acclaimed night-spot Zee Bar here in Philly. His outfit was perfect for the stylish party, as well as, his role as a night club director (which usually allows for more creativity in your dress).

Style Tip?
This is one look that I like completely, however; the trend of the lens-less glasses is the only thing I would change. The red frame does add some color consistency with the red leather boots, but, a red trim pocket square would have had the same affect.
